Keto Crab Rangoons

Keto Crab Rangoons That Will Make You Forget Takeout

Delicious Keto Crab Rangoons made with homemade Fathead dough, perfect for satisfying your cravings without the carbs.
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Cooling Time 5 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Servings: 4 pieces
Course: Appetizers
Cuisine: American
Calories: 120

Ingredients
  

For the Filling
  • 8 oz Cream Cheese Use full-fat for best flavor.
  • 1 cup Lump Crab Meat Avoid imitation crab for keto.
  • 2 Green Onions Chopped; chives can be substituted.
  • 2 Minced Garlic Cloves Fresh is ideal but garlic powder works.
  • 1 tsp Grated Ginger Fresh ginger brightens the flavor.
For the Dough
  • 1 cup Shredded Mozzarella Cheese A vegan cheese blend can be used.
  • 1.5 cups Almond Flour Coconut flour may require adjustments.
  • 1 Egg Beaten.
  • Salt & Pepper Adjust to taste.

Equipment

  • mixing bowl
  • Microwave
  • Rolling Pin
  • Baking Sheet

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. In a mixing bowl, combine 8 oz of softened cream cheese with 1 cup of lump crab meat, 2 chopped green onions, 2 minced garlic cloves, and 1 tsp of grated ginger. Blend until smooth and well-mixed.
  2. In a heat-safe bowl, combine 1 cup of shredded mozzarella cheese and 2 oz of cream cheese. Microwave for 1-2 minutes until melted and smooth. Stir in 1 ½ cups of almond flour and 1 beaten egg until a sticky dough forms.
  3. Place the dough between two sheets of parchment paper and roll out until about 1/8 inch thick. Cut the dough into 3-inch squares.
  4. Take a square of dough and place approximately 1 tablespoon of the crab filling in the center. Fold the corners up to create a pocket and press edges together to seal.
  5.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Place assembled rangoons on a baking sheet and bake for 12-15 minutes until golden brown.
  6. Allow baked rangoons to cool on the baking sheet for about 5 minutes. Serve warm with a keto-friendly dipping sauce.
